NewsBytez 25.7.11

-Amy Winehouse's autopsy and inquest into her death has not revealed a cause of death. The toxicology reports will take an additional 2-4 weeks for results. A private funeral is planned for the singer on Tuesday July 26th. The singer's masterwork, Back to Black, is poised to top the charts in several countries.

-Anders Breivik, the terrorist responsible for killing over 70 people during the weekend in Norway, will receive a maximum sentence of no more than 21 years. Norway's justice system heavily believes in prisoner rehabilitation and prevents long sentences and has no death penalty.

Report: Singer Amy Winehouse dead

Amy Winehouse (27) was found dead in her London, England apartment today at 4PM local time. Her cause of death is currently unknown and she battled with addiction throughout her life. She most recently made headlines when she was forced to cancel a tour a few weeks ago. Though she only released two albums, they spawned several hit singles and rocketed her to fame. She is credited with bringing Blue-Eyed Soul back to the forefront and helped pave the way for stars like Adele and Duffy.
